Company Description
Payarc is a technology-driven payments company built to empower people and improve their organizations, one payment at a time. What began as smart, simple payment-processing tools and products has grown into a broader platform, backed by a team of world-class experts and top technology talent. We help new businesses get started, increase our customers' revenues, and bridge the gap between merchants and modern payment solutions---giving companies the tools they need to change the future of their business.
Position SummaryThe Software Engineer II is a mid-level engineering role responsible for designing, developing, testing, and maintaining scalable software solutions with limited guidance. This role owns features and components end-to-end and collaborates with cross-functional teams to deliver high-quality payment applications, services, and systems.
The Software Engineer II contributes across all phases of the software development lifecycle---from requirements analysis through deployment and ongoing support---and is expected to uphold Payarc's engineering standards and secure, PCI DSS-compliant data-handling practices.

Payarc engineers work across a broad, modern technology stack. Depending on the team and project, you may work with:
- Backend: PHP (Laravel, Nova, Apiato) and services in languages such as Java, C#, Python, Go, and C
- Frontend: JavaScript with React and Angular, plus jQuery; HTML5, CSS3, LESS/SASS;
Material Design - Mobile: native Android (Kotlin, Java) and iOS (Swift, Objective-C), with cross-platform work in React Native/Flutter; libraries such as Retrofit, OkHttp, and Firebase
- Data: relational databases (MySQL, Oracle, Firebird) and No
SQL data stores - Cloud & Dev Ops: Amazon Web Services (AWS), Git/Git Hub, CI/CD pipelines, Docker, and Kubernetes
- Payments & security: PCI DSS-compliant systems, encryption standards such as TDES and DUKPT, and integrations with POS systems, terminals (e.g., PAX, AMP), and Magtek card readers
- AI & machine learning: applied ML and LLM-based workflows in Python (Tensor Flow, PyTorch, scikit-learn), including vector databases and embeddings
- Collaboration & tooling: Agile/Scrum delivery with JIRA and Confluence, and application monitoring with tools such as Crashlytics and New Relic
